FedEx is a dominant player and the management team proves they can execute. The founder family still owns a lot of shares, and such families don't make crazy decision to preserve their stake. Also, cost savings and a huge share buyback are plusses. Also, they have fewer unionized employees than UPS.
He owned it for a decade, but got stopped out last year. It's down 30% off its highs, but 70% of their business is NOT e-commerce. They have lots of room to grow into e-commerce. Some individual brands are bypassing Amazon and using FedEx directly to deliver. 50-60% of Walmart deliveries use FedEx who are putting 500 stores into Walmarts. Good brand and valuation.
